Carlsbad North Cdp, New Mexico
According to 2000 Census Bureau, there were 1245 residents, 457 households, and 284 families in the census designated place. The population density was 851.1 people per square mile (328.61/kmē), it is the 55th most densely populated census designated place in the U.S. state of New Mexico. There were 526 housing units at an average density of 360.3 per square mile (139.11/kmē). The average household size was 2.57 and the average family size was 2.97. In the census designated place Population was distributed with 26.3% under the age of 18, 5.2% from 18 to 24, 21.4% from 25 to 44, 31% from 45 to 64, and 16% who were 65 or older. For every 100 females there were 100.2 males. For every 100 females age 18 and over, there were 100.7 males. The median age of the census designated place's population was 43.6 years, the median age of male residents at 43.8 and the median age of female residents at 43.3. The racial or ethnic makeup of the census designated place was 1153 White, 4 Black or African American, 4 American Indian, 10 Asian, 5 Native Hawaiian, 12 from two or more races and 57 Ohter races.
The median income for a household in the census designated place was $52361, making it the 12th wealthiest census designated place by median household income among the New Mexico. The median income for a family in the census designated place was $69135, making it the ninth wealthiest census designated place by median family income among the New Mexico. The per capita income for the census designated place was $27192, it is the 13th wealthiest census designated place in terms of per capita income. The median income was $31728, Males had a median income of $40833 versus $24957 for females.
